     Ralph Raymond Wilbur was born on 11 January 1888, Nebraska.1 He was the son of Eugene Bonaparte Wilbur and Mary Ellen Savage.1
     Ralph Raymond Wilbur appeared on the 1900 Federal Census of South Sioux City, Dakota, Nebraska in the household of his parents, Eugene Bonaparte Wilbur and Mary Ellen Wilbur.2
     Ralph Raymond Wilbur died in December 1962 at the age of 74.1
